While obviously not the cheapest way to get around or move between intercity destinations, a taxi trip is a great way for those who do not like restrictions of fixed schedules and routes. With taxis offering convenient and customized door-to-door service, it is easy to tailor-make your trip by adding the extras you need – for example, a car seat. Normally you can choose a car of a certain class or a bigger vehicle to accommodate your party. To ensure you will get the best service, do negotiate in advance if you need to call several places enroute or make additional stops for meals or sightseeing.

Travel by Taxi: Pros & Cons

Pros of Taxi Travel

  • Travelling by taxi allows you to avoid crowded bus terminals
    and train stations and keep social distancing which is a good point for those on alert to the pandemic challenges.
  • With a taxi, you have complete flexibility – depart when it is more convenient for you, plan enroute stops for rest or meals, and choose the route you want – not necessarily the shortest one. Yet do remember that it is better to discuss all these points with the operator before your trip to
    allow them to calculate the cost which will include all add-ons. Otherwise, the final bill can be an unpleasant surprise.
  • Taxis can bring you to destinations that are not served by any other means of public transport. The most remote villages and locations where no buses or trains bring you can be reached by taxi. The good point is to remember that it is sometimes pays to book a round trip to and from such destinations as it can be challenging to find return transport without prior booking.

Cons of Taxi Travel

  • Cost is the major drawback of a taxi ride. You will definitely end up paying more for a taxi than for a bus or train journey, but it is quite natural that private service does come at a price, so be ready to shell out.
  • Also be ready to pay more for any detours or extra stops not included into the calculation of your fare. Normally the price shown in search results is the net price for the ride from point A to B. To avoid disappointment, remember to mention all your requirements to the trip before you book. Otherwise, your car may be assigned for the next trip, and the driver will not be able to follow your immediate requests.
  • Music or just talkative taxi drivers can be a problem – politely insist on switching off the music if you do not feel like listening to it and do not hesitate to tell the driver you are not inclined to keep up the conversation.
  • Taxi drivers are notorious for their love to use strange routes or minor roads which – as
    they may think – allow them to beat traffic jams or escape bad roads. If you follow your trip route on Google Maps, it can be quite disturbing to see you deviate from Google’s recommendations.
